And my understanding is the reason they chose this location is when these photos come out, it's going to be a very iconic shot. | |
Of all these people linked hand in hand going across the bridge. | |
Because before this, you know, you'd have marches, demonstrations, prayer vigils, you know, 50 people here, a thousand people there. | |
They said, let's get everybody together at one time and in one place so we can really show how many people are in support of the nine victims of Emanuel AME. And as I'm speaking to you, there are several people still arriving, even... | |
